Minnesota’s DWI and DUI laws are strict, and your case moves fast from the moment of arrest, with immediate deadlines affecting your license, implied consent rights, and court obligations in Austin and across MN.

A DWI case actually involves two separate battles — the criminal charges and the driver’s license/implied consent process. Missing early deadlines or taking the wrong step can cost you critical rights, even if the criminal case is later reduced or dismissed.

Austin DWI Lawyer FAQs

Most cases begin with an initial appearance or arraignment where charges are read and plea decisions are made. We make sure you understand each step and your options at every hearing.
Many DWI cases involve several hearings for scheduling, motion practice, and negotiations. Your lawyer can often handle routine appearances and make sure you are prepared when your presence is required.
Pretrial motions ask the judge to decide legal issues, such as whether to suppress evidence or dismiss certain charges. Strong motions can significantly change the outcome of a case.
Dismissal is possible when evidence is weak, rights were violated, or key procedures were not followed. We thoroughly review each case for legal grounds that may support dismissal.
DWI cases can take several months or longer depending on the court’s schedule, the complexity of the evidence, and whether you decide to go to trial.
